A Place of Reverence: The Kashi Vishwanath Temple

Within the heart of Varanasi, a city steeped in sacred tradition, stands the magnificent Kashi Vishwanath Temple. This temple is celebrated as one of the twelve Jyotirlinga temples dedicated to Lord Shiva, drawing worshippers from far and wide. The temple's golden spire stands tall against the backdrop of the Ganges River, its splendor a testament to India's rich religious history.

Inside, the inner sanctum houses the divine symbol of Lord Shiva, attracting countless devotees in awe. The air is thick with religious fervor, as hymns are chanted and prayers are offered.

The Kashi Vishwanath Temple represents a spiritual journey for those who experience its sacred aura. It is a place where spirits soar, reminding us of the depth of spirituality.
